if it's an error for imx8qxp mek board

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

if it's an error for imx8qxp mek board

1,901 Views
chenzilin
Contributor I

Hello:

   I am working on imx8qxp mek, but I recently ran into a problem.

No1:

mkdir yoctofsl && cd yoctofsl
mkdir build
rep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-morty -m imx-4.9.51-8mq_beta.xml
repo sync

ln -s sources/meta-fsl-bsp-release/imx/tools/fsl-setup-release.sh fsl-setup-release.sh
ln -s sources/base/README README
ln -s sources/meta-fsl-bsp-release/imx/README README-IMXBSP
ln -s sources/base/setup-environment setup-environment

MACHINE=imx8qxpmek DISTRO=fsl-imx-fb source fsl-setup-release.sh -b imx-fb
bitbake fsl-image-qt5-validation-imx

No2:

mkdir yoctofsl && cd yoctofsl
mkdir build
rep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-morty -m imx-4.9.51-8mq_ga.xml
repo sync

ln -s sources/meta-fsl-bsp-release/imx/tools/fsl-setup-release.sh fsl-setup-release.sh
ln -s sources/base/README README
ln -s sources/meta-fsl-bsp-release/imx/README README-IMXBSP
ln -s sources/base/setup-environment setup-environment

MACHINE=imx8qxpmek DISTRO=fsl-imx-fb source fsl-setup-release.sh -b imx-fb
bitbake fsl-image-qt5-validation-imx

the No2 compile failed!

imx-gpu-viv-6.2.4.p1.0-aarch64 depends on wayland but imx-gpu-viv don't,

below:

0.PNG

1.PNG

 Why?

Labels (2)
0 Kudos
4 Replies

1,036 Views
chenzilin
Contributor I

rep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-morty -m imx-4.9.51-8qm_beta2.xml

MACHINE=imx8qxpmek DISTRO=fsl-imx-fb source fsl-setup-release.sh -b imx-fb
bitbake fsl-image-qt5-validation-imx

I do this three lines  and I can run it on my board

cp Image ~/imx8
cp imx-boot-imx8qxpmek-sd.bin-flash ~/imx8/
cp Image-fsl-imx8qxp-mek-lvds0-it6263.dtb ~/imx8/fsl-imx8qxp-mek.dtb
cp fsl-image-qt5-validation-imx-imx8qxpmek.tar.bz2 ~/imx8/rootfs.tar.bz2

but I have an another question. as the image below. The gradual change is very unsmooth!!!

微信图片_20180413100931.jpg


then i found my fbset below:

111.PNG

Why? is it relevant with color depth? and how can i change it to 32bit color depth?

0 Kudos

1,036 Views
isaac_ng
NXP Employee
NXP Employee

You are using the manifest for i.MX8M EVK board.

rep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-morty -m imx-4.9.51-8mq_beta.xml

repo init -u https://source.codeaurora.org/external/imx/imx-manifest -b imx-linux-morty -m imx-4.9.51-8mq_ga.xml

0 Kudos

1,036 Views
Bio_TICFSL
NXP TechSupport
NXP TechSupport

Hi chen,

Take in mind that fsl-imx-wayland and fsl-imx-fb are not validated in this distro. try to use x11.

0 Kudos

1,036 Views
ortogonal
Contributor III

But if fsl-imx-wayland is not valid it's even more strange that gbm_viv.so depends on libwayland-server.so.0.
There is a differens between version imx-gpu-viv-6.2.4.p0.2-aarch64 and imx-gpu-viv-6.2.4.p1.0-aarch64. Where the later has a strange dependency in to libwayland-server in gbm_viv.so. Why is that?

0 Kudos